www.cornwallmodelboats.co.uk/acatalog/new-maquettes-france.htmlThis is the Cornwall Model Boats version. New Maquettes Le France Ocean Liner from general Transatlantic Company. Built at Atlantic Ship Yards & launched 11 May 1960. Working model supplied complete with fittings kit AFRA, including 1100 brass portholes. Plank on frame construction with pre-cut wooden parts, fittings set, plans with supplemental English instruction manual included Scale 1:200. Length 1580mm Width 170mm.
